一、AI代理技术架构解析
在数字化转型浪潮中,AI代理(Agentic AI)已成为自动化数据处理的核心范式。与传统规则驱动系统不同,AI代理通过大语言模型(LLMs)实现目标导向的自主决策,其技术架构包含三个核心层级:
-
决策中枢层
基于Transformer架构的LLMs构成系统大脑,负责解析用户需求、拆解任务步骤、动态调整执行策略。例如处理”分析季度销售趋势”请求时,模型会自动识别需要数据时间范围、对比维度等关键参数。 -
工具链集成层
通过标准化接口连接各类数据处理工具,形成可扩展的工具矩阵。典型组件包括:
- 数据采集:Web爬虫框架/API连接器
- 清洗转换:Pandas/Spark数据处理引擎
- 分析建模:Scikit-learn/TensorFlow算法库
- 可视化:Matplotlib/ECharts渲染组件
- 执行反馈层
构建闭环控制系统,实时监控任务执行状态。当遇到数据缺失、API限流等异常时,系统会自动触发重试机制或调整执行路径。某金融企业的实践数据显示,该机制使任务成功率从72%提升至95%。
二、核心开发流程详解
2.1 环境准备与工具选型
推荐采用Python生态构建原型系统,关键依赖包括:
# 基础环境配置示例requirements = ["langchain>=0.1.0", # LLMs集成框架"pandas>=2.0.0", # 数据处理"apache-airflow>=2.7.0", # 工作流编排"prometheus-client>=0.17" # 监控告警]
对于大规模数据处理场景,建议采用容器化部署方案。通过Kubernetes集群实现计算资源弹性伸缩,配合对象存储服务处理TB级数据文件。
2.2 决策引擎开发要点
- 提示词工程优化
设计结构化提示模板,明确指定输出格式:
```
任务目标:{用户原始需求}
执行步骤: - 确定分析时间范围(默认最近3个月)
- 识别关键指标(销售额/客单价/转化率)
-
生成可视化建议(折线图/柱状图组合)
输出格式:JSON对象,包含steps数组和visualization字段
``` -
动态工具调度算法
实现基于上下文感知的工具选择机制:def select_tool(context):if "SQL查询" in context:return DatabaseTool(dialect="mysql")elif "网页数据" in context:return WebScraperTool(headers=DEFAULT_HEADERS)# 其他工具选择逻辑...
2.3 异常处理体系构建
建立三级异常响应机制:
- 一级异常:数据格式错误等可自动修复问题,触发数据清洗流程
- 二级异常:API调用失败等暂时性故障,实施指数退避重试策略
- 三级异常:业务逻辑冲突等根本性问题,生成详细错误报告并通知人工介入
某电商平台的实践表明,该体系使系统无故障运行时间(MTBF)提升300%。
三、进阶功能实现方案
3.1 多模态分析能力集成
通过LLMs的跨模态理解能力,实现文本报告与图表的联合分析:
用户请求:"解释销售下滑原因,并生成配套PPT"系统响应:1. 调用时序分析工具生成趋势图2. 运用NLP模型解析评论数据情感倾向3. 使用LaTeX引擎自动生成分析报告4. 调用PPT生成API完成可视化排版
3.2 持续学习机制设计
构建双循环学习系统:
- 内循环:基于用户反馈优化提示词模板
- 外循环:定期用新数据微调领域专用模型
实验数据显示,经过10个迭代周期后,系统对业务术语的理解准确率从68%提升至89%。
四、生产环境部署建议
4.1 性能优化策略
- 模型轻量化:采用知识蒸馏技术将参数量从175B压缩至13B,推理速度提升5倍
- 缓存机制:对高频查询结果建立Redis缓存,命中率可达85%
- 并行计算:使用Dask框架实现数据处理任务并行化
4.2 安全合规方案
- 数据加密:传输过程采用TLS 1.3,存储使用AES-256加密
- 访问控制:实施基于RBAC的权限管理系统
- 审计日志:完整记录所有数据操作轨迹,满足GDPR等合规要求
五、典型应用场景实践
5.1 实时业务监控
某物流企业部署的AI代理系统,可自动:
- 每15分钟采集全国仓储数据
- 识别库存异常波动(±15%阈值)
- 生成调拨建议并触发工作流
- 通过企业微信推送预警信息
系统上线后,库存周转率提升22%,缺货率下降37%。
5.2 自动化报告生成
某金融机构的月度分析报告生成流程:
- 连接15个数据源自动采集数据
- 执行32项预设分析指标计算
- 生成包含20张图表的Word报告
- 通过邮件自动分发给相关人员
整个过程从原来的72人时缩短至8分钟,且错误率趋近于零。
六、未来发展趋势展望
随着LLMs技术的演进,AI代理系统将呈现三大发展方向:
- 自主进化能力:通过强化学习实现策略的自我优化
- 跨系统协作:构建企业级AI代理网络,实现跨部门协同
- 边缘计算部署:在终端设备上运行轻量化代理,降低延迟
据行业预测,到2026年,将有65%的数据分析工作由AI代理系统自动完成。开发者需持续关注模型压缩、联邦学习等关键技术的发展,以构建更具竞争力的解决方案。
本文完整呈现了从理论架构到工程实践的全流程,开发者可根据实际业务需求调整技术选型和实现细节。建议从MVP版本开始迭代,逐步完善功能体系,最终构建企业级智能数据分析平台。